Chana gains 0.27% as demand picks up
Speculators created fresh positions, tracking a firm trend at spot market following pick-up in demand

Chana prices gained 0.27% to Rs 4,102 per quintal in futures trade today as speculators created fresh positions, tracking a firm trend at spot market following pick-up in demand.
At the National Commodity and Derivatives Exchange, the January contract rose by Rs 11, or 0.27%, to Rs 4,102 per quintal with an open interest of 86,190 lots.
The December contract gained Rs 7, or 0.16%, to Rs 4,262 per quintal in 67,840 lots.
Market analysts attributed the rise in chana prices at futures trade to fresh positions created by speculators, tracking a firm trend at spot market on pick-up in demand.
